Greenville's Shammond Williams, once basketball star, dreamed of working on Wall Street
Posted Feb 2, 2019
Although people know Shammond Williams for his college and professional basketball careers, his passion leading up to basketball was music. He was a skilled drummer and French horn player whose career goals were simple. “The only thing I wanted to do was show people I was a good basketball player, but my ultimate dream was to work on Wall Street,” Williams said.
